ACC chairman, two commissioners resign
Dr Mohammad Abdul Momen, chairman of the Anti-Corruption Commission (ACC), and two commissioners have resigned.
They submitted their resignation letters to the Cabinet Division on Tuesday, March 3.
While leaving after submitting the resignations, Commissioner Minha Mohammad Ali Akbar Azizi told journalists that the chairman and two commissioners resigned through a formal process, not under any pressure.
Dr Mohammad Abdul Momen was serving as the ACC chairman.
No detailed reason for the resignations has been officially announced by the government.
The matter has sparked discussions in administrative circles.
